Mendiola of the PSS-Human Resources Office said she is “happy and proud for being named the overall central office support staff of the year. My family is so proud of me. I have been working for PSS for a long time but I will not get tired of assisting people who are in need of my help.”
Mendiola started working for PSS on Dec. 12, 1994.
Various program managers and colleagues commended her for “exuding a sense of pride and loyalty that was infectious.”
Her “positive attitude also raises a productive work environment to those around her and those who work with the human resources department.”
Mendiola, PSS said, always perks up those who are having a bad day.
Others described her as “proactive, responsive, the best.”
Her supervisor said Mendiola “could very well be considered the glue that holds the PSS Human Resources Office together.”
